Sigh. I think the president of the UCC church has it right:
It’s also important to name the painful reality that many candidates and public officials now find it nearly impossible to be an active member of a particular religious community, given our divisive political culture. Faith is rooted in community. Persons in public office should have the same opportunity, as the rest of us, to experience the worship, prayers and close personal friendships that congregational participation affords.My prayers are with the Obamas as they seek out spiritual consistency in a politics that abhors a vacuum of scandal and controversy.
